Definition

If someone is "laid up," they are forced to stay in bed or rest, usually because of illness or injury.

Listen in Context

He was laid up with the flu for a week.

My grandmother is laid up after her surgery.

Jake got laid up when he broke his leg.

I was laid up all weekend with a terrible cold; I didn't leave my bed.
